Output e6b60c6160d6a66fd961efc90ff79f525a45c0546b38fd7cf85b07c423f56799:0

value
15840800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32349d09c44c87f634440cb58f5610a17a591a8 OP_EQUALVERIFY OP_CHECKSIG
address
1MhzfRVerTtv58WvbcFe3wX9zBW5fXZaEQ
transaction
e6b60c6160d6a66fd961efc90ff79f525a45c0546b38fd7cf85b07c423f56799
spent
true